On Wed, 4 Apr 2001, Geert Uytterhoeven wrote:
> What about modifying dpkg so it can install the lib and include parts of
> non-native packages for arch $ARCH in /usr/$ARCH-linux/? Thay way you can
> easily install *-dev packages for cross-development.
I'm not sure if that actually solves the problem. I think
cross-compilation libraries need to be built specifically for this purpose
as bits might be different, such as in the case of
/usr/mipsel-linux/lib/libc.so, which has to be different from the
mipsel-linux native /usr/lib/libc.so. Cross-compilation libraries might
be built as noarch packages as they are actually independent from the
build system they are installed on.
